Box Type Transformers: Installation Guide

Introduction:

Transformers are essential electrical equipment used to transfer electrical energy between circuits. Box type transformers, specifically, are widely used for residential, commercial, and industrial applications due to their compact design and efficient performance. In this installation guide, we will walk you through the step-by-step process of installing box type transformers, ensuring a safe and effective setup.

Importance of Proper Installation

Proper installation of box type transformers is crucial to ensure optimal performance, efficiency, and safety. Incorrect installation can lead to various problems, such as voltage fluctuations, overheating, electrical malfunctions, or even pose a risk of fire hazards. Following the correct installation procedures is fundamental for both the longevity of the transformer and the safety of the surrounding electrical infrastructure.

Identifying Suitable Location

Before commencing the installation process, it is vital to choose an appropriate location for your box type transformer. Consider the following factors when identifying a suitable spot:

- Accessibility: Ensure the transformer is easily accessible for routine maintenance and repairs.

- Ventilation: Adequate ventilation is crucial to prevent excessive heat build-up. Choose a location with sufficient airflow to maintain the transformer's temperature within safe limits.

- Load Distribution: The selected location should be able to handle the load requirements and ensure a balanced distribution of power to various circuits.

Once you have identified an ideal location, proceed with the installation process, following the guidelines below.

Preparing the Installation Site

It is essential to prepare the installation site properly to ensure a smooth and trouble-free installation process. Pay attention to the following steps:

1. Clear the area: Remove any obstructions, debris, or objects that might interfere with the installation process. Ensure a clean and clutter-free environment around the transformer.

2. Adequate space: Provide sufficient space for the transformer, adhering to the manufacturer's specifications. Leave appropriate clearance on all sides to accommodate maintenance and future expansion if required.

3. Level surface: The installation site must have a level surface to ensure stability and prevent any imbalance or tilting of the transformer.

Obtaining Proper Tools and Equipment

Before starting the installation, gather all the necessary tools and equipment required. The following list should give you an idea of what you might need:

- Screwdrivers

- Wrenches

- Insulation tape

- Cable connectors

- Wire strippers

- Safety gloves and goggles

- Cable ties

- Voltmeter

Having the appropriate tools and equipment readily available will ensure a seamless installation process and minimize any delays or complications.

Connecting the Transformer

Once the preparation is complete, you can proceed with connecting the box type transformer. Follow the steps below, ensuring precision and accuracy during the process:

1. Power supply disconnection: Prior to connecting the transformer, ensure the power supply is switched off and disconnected. This is crucial to prevent electrocution or any damage to the equipment during installation.

2. Cable routing: Plan the routing of input and output cables based on the transformer's location and proximity to the power source and the load circuits. Ensure appropriate cable lengths are available for connection, avoiding any unnecessary tension or strain.

3. Cable termination: Strip the cable ends appropriately and attach them securely to the input and output terminals of the transformer. Use the recommended connectors and tighten them adequately to ensure proper contact and minimize any resistance.

4. Insulation: After connecting the cables, insulate the exposed portions using insulation tape to prevent accidental contact, short circuits, or damage due to moisture or dust.

Testing and Commissioning

Once the connections are in place, it is essential to test and commission the box type transformer to ensure its functionality and safety. Follow these steps before activating the power supply:

1. Visual inspection: Thoroughly inspect the installed transformer, its connections, and the surrounding environment. Look for any loose connections, signs of damage, or abnormal conditions.

2. Voltage testing: Use a voltmeter to check the output voltage of the transformer. Compare the readings with the required specifications to ensure proper functioning.

3. Load testing: Gradually introduce load to the transformers' output circuits and monitor its performance. Verify that the transformer operates within acceptable temperature limits and that there are no abnormal voltage drops or fluctuations during the testing.

4. Safety precautions: Before activating the power supply, provide adequate safety measures such as proper grounding, installing protective devices, and ensuring suitable ventilation.

Summary

Proper installation of box type transformers is crucial for optimal performance, efficiency, and safety. From selecting the appropriate location to meticulous cable connections and thorough testing, each step is vital to ensure a successful installation. By following this installation guide, you can confidently set up box type transformers, minimizing the risk of electrical issues and ensuring long-term reliability. Always refer to the manufacturer's instructions and consult a professional electrician if you encounter any challenges or uncertainties during the installation process.

How to handle abnormal operation of transformers?
As soon as the transformer is powered on, there is a buzzing sound, mainly due to the effect of high-voltage magnetic flux. During normal operation, the sound of the transformer is uniform. When there are other noises, the cause should be carefully investigated and dealt with.
